Accreditations and the Certification Exam
Qualifications can be a genuine booster for your resume, showing employing supervisors you've passed an identified certification test. The CompTIA A+ is commonly considered the portal credential for assistance functions. It covers:
- Hardware installment and maintenance
- Operating systems and software application troubleshooting
- Networking principles
Many prospects spend two to three months preparing, utilizing technique tests and video clip training courses. The cost varies-- on average, plan for \$200-- \$300 per examination-- yet numerous companies provide reimbursement as soon as you pass.
Browsing Job Interviews and Frequently Asked Questions
In my first round of job meetings, I came across some classic questions. To assist you prepare, right here are a few regularly asked inquiries:
1. How would you repair a sluggish computer?
Walk the interviewer with your procedure: inspecting running procedures, scanning for malware, validating readily available disk area, and screening network speeds. Real-life narratives-- like discovering a rogue update procedure gobbling up CPU-- make your solution memorable.
2. What's your information backup approach?
Clarify the 3-2-1 regulation: 3 duplicates of data, on two various media, with one duplicate offsite. Share any type of experience you have actually establishing automated back-ups or restoring from a cloud photo.
